CKFinder features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    CKFinder offers a clean and intuitive interface that allows users to easily browse, upload, and manage files with minimal effort, enhancing user experience.
  • Seamless CKEditor Integration
    It integrates seamlessly with CKEditor, allowing for easy incorporation of file management capabilities into the rich text editor environment.
  • Multi-language Support
    CKFinder supports multiple languages, making it accessible to a diverse range of users and suitable for international applications.
  • Responsive Design
    The application is mobile-friendly, offering a responsive design that ensures usability across various devices and screen sizes.
  • Extensive Customization Options
    CKFinder can be customized extensively in terms of appearance and functionality, allowing developers to tailor the tool to specific project needs.

Possible disadvantages of CKFinder

  • License Cost
    CKFinder is a commercial product, which means there might be a significant cost involved, especially for small businesses or individual developers.
  • Complex Configuration
    Initial setup and configuration can be complex, requiring a learning curve and technical understanding to fully implement all features.
  • Dependence on CKEditor
    While it offers seamless integration with CKEditor, its utility can be limited without it, which could be a drawback for those not using CKEditor.
  • Server-Side Requirements
    CKFinder requires server-side code execution (PHP, ASP.NET, Java, etc.), which could be a limitation for environments that do not support these technologies.
  • Limited Standalone Use
    While CKFinder is designed to work alongside CKEditor, its standalone functionality might not be as robust or appealing for those seeking a purely file management solution.

Tiny File Manager features and specs

  • Lightweight
    Tiny File Manager is a lightweight application, making it quick to load and use without consuming significant server resources.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    It offers a simple and intuitive interface, which makes it easy for users to navigate and manage files without a steep learning curve.
  • Multi-User Support
    Allows the creation of multiple users with personalized permissions, making it suitable for collaborative environments.
  • No Database Requirement
    Operates without the need for a database, simplifying installation and maintenance efforts.
  • Open Source
    Being open-source software, it allows developers to contribute and customize it according to their needs.

Possible disadvantages of Tiny File Manager

  • Limited Advanced Features
    Lacks some of the advanced features available in more comprehensive file management solutions, such as workflow automation and advanced search capabilities.
  • Security Concerns
    As with many web-based file managers, it may pose security risks if not properly configured or regularly updated.
  • Basic Support
    Relies primarily on community support, which may not be as responsive or comprehensive as professional support services in case of issues.
  • Potential Compatibility Issues
    Compatibility with different server environments may vary, and users might encounter issues depending on their setup.
